About the role
Key responsibilities & impact- Provides initial and annual assessments, education, and case management services to a complex, often long-term group of assigned clients, which includes in-home visits
- Prepares, evaluates, and maintains a service plan to meet the needs of the client including both Catholic Charities programs and other available community resources
- Supports and advocates on behalf of clients in the procurement of services and benefits entitlement, assisting with required paperwork as necessary
- Consults, cooperates, and educates community systems to facilitate linkage, referral, crisis management and follow up, focusing on attaining goals
- Maintains complete case documentation and records, as required by Catholic Charities, the funders, or licensure/regulatory bodies
- Coordinates with the supervisor on all aspects of client care and seeks appropriate guidance and feedback from other team members
- Utilizes behavior management, trauma-informed, person-centered, and solution-focused techniques to facilitate personal growth and minimize crisis
- May facilitate group or individual meetings to provide education, teach critical skills, and/or provide support for program participants
- Mentors other individuals within program
- May transport clients dependent on program guidelines and needs
Requirements
What you’ll need- Current Social Work licensure approved by the State of Minnesota required (e.g. LSW, LGSW)
- Bachelor’s or master’s degree in social work, Psychology, Sociology, Human Services, or related field preferred
- Or a bachelor’s degree with a major in any field and at least one (1) year of experience as a social worker/case manager/care coordinator in a public or private social services agency
- Pass DHS background check and meet their requirements for the provision of case management by meeting the social work standards under the MN Merit System
- Ability to work with diverse and/or low-income populations, including those who may be experiencing homelessness, unstable housing, and/or mental illness required
- Must have a valid driver’s license and proof of current insurance coverage
